Being invited to the feast of a ruler is a great honour. In the book of Esther we read that the great celebration of King Xerxes ran for 6 months. It included the top ranking officials of the Persian Empire in 470 BC. The common people of Susa were also invited to a 7 day banquet. This was lavish and opulent and hosted in the inner palace courts.

You are invited to the feast

We have also been invited to a wonderful feast! In Isaiah 25:6-9 we read of the feast of the King of Kings which Christians, the Bride of Christ, are looking forward to. On this day God will remove death, tears and all reproach from us. We will be covered by his righteousness.
